City Authorizes Application for OTIB Infrastructure Loan

The City of Gold Hill adopted Resolution 26-R-14 authorizing application for an Oregon Transportation Infrastructure Bank (OTIB) loan. The financing would support expansion of the municipal water line across the Highway 99 Bridge in coordination with ODOT’s replacement project.
